Defining What an Appointment Setting Certification Is
An Appointment Setting certification is a structured training program designed to equip professionals with the essential skills and tools needed to effectively set and manage appointments with potential clients or business leads. It focuses on enhancing communication, persuasion, and time management abilities, along with technical proficiency in customer relationship management (CRM) systems. Certified programs usually include modules that cover lead generation strategies, sales funnel understanding, script optimization, and objection handling. The goal is to help participants build confidence and competence in managing outbound and inbound calls, qualifying prospects, and maintaining professionalism in every interaction. Many reputable institutions and online platforms offer accredited Appointment Setting certification courses that follow global sales standards. These programs often include assessments, role-playing exercises, and practical simulations to ensure mastery of real-world appointment setting scenarios. Earning this certification means demonstrating both theoretical knowledge and practical expertise, making you a valuable asset to employers seeking efficient and persuasive communicators.

Choosing the Right Appointment Setting Certification Program
Selecting the right Appointment Setting certification program requires thoughtful consideration of several factors. First, it’s important to evaluate the course content—look for comprehensive modules that cover communication, sales psychology, and CRM systems. The best programs also provide practical exercises, such as mock calls and scenario-based simulations, to ensure that learners can apply their knowledge effectively. Accreditation matters as well; choose a course recognized by credible industry bodies or well-reviewed online training providers.
Other important considerations include:
- Course duration and flexibility (self-paced or instructor-led)
- Cost versus value (including post-training support and resources)
- Real-world practice opportunities or internship options
- Feedback and reviews from past participants
Comparing different providers can help you find one that fits your learning style, schedule, and career goals. Online programs are particularly popular among remote professionals and virtual assistants who prefer to learn at their own pace. However, in-person courses may offer more hands-on coaching and direct interaction with trainers. Ultimately, the ideal certification program combines theory, practice, and mentorship for long-term success.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
What qualifications do I need before taking an Appointment Setting certification?
Most programs are open to anyone with strong communication skills and an interest in sales or client relations. A background in customer service or telemarketing can be helpful but isn’t required.
How long does it take to complete the certification?
Program length varies, but most certifications can be completed within a few weeks to a few months, depending on whether the training is full-time or self-paced.
Are online certifications credible?
Yes, many online certifications are accredited and recognized globally. The key is to select programs from reputable institutions or platforms with verified industry credentials.
